Zoo Med Reptile Basking Spot Lamp 75 Watts 2 Bulb Value PackI bought a two pack of these bulbs from a local retailer on 14 March. Worked great initially, but I was pretty disgusted when I came home from work on 26 March to find the lamp burned out. A week and a half? I thought perhaps the bulb overheated or something, although you'd figure a *heat lamp* would be designed to tolerate high heat. Anyway, I tilted the bowl fixture from almost straight down to about 35 degrees off of vertical to allow more heat to escape, and aimed a pretty small fan at the top of the fixture to cool it. The second bulb blew out on 8 April, giving me an average bulb life of about 12 days--but considering the bulbs were on a 10 hour timer, they lasted for about 120 hours each. Totally unacceptable! Since then I've had a regular Philips 100W reflector spot bulb and it's been working great for 61 days. An email I sent to Zoo Med has gone unanswered for weeks. I won't be buying anything from Zoo Med again.

I purchased a double 75w pack of these bulbs. I use them for my uromastyx cage where the basking temp. has to be at 120 degrees and the lights on for 10 hrs a day. The first bulb I used lasted a little more than a month. The second one that I had used didn't even last a month. I feel that this bulb should last longer than this. I used the equivalent bulb from a different brand and it lasted months!
